Description Title Youth Educator, Millbrook Community Center at P.S. 65x Summer 2026 Non-Exempt, Seasonal Salary Range $20 per hour Reports to Program Director Location 677 E. 141th Street Bronx, NY 10454 Program Mill Brook Community Center Organization Summary East Side House, founded in 1891, is a 501(c) (3) organization that has served the South Bronx since 1963. The organization is dedicated to the community and focused on providing resources and opportunities. East Side House has identified that education is the foundation for economic improvement. Its youth education and technology programs teach skills to allow its students and clients to become more self-sufficient and independent. As a community resource, the organization also provides services to families and a growing senior population. In 2020 the organization began food distribution as an additional way to provide economic support to the community we serve. ESH summer camp programs offer students additional learning time in a fun, engaging, and safe environment. Students are offered a wide variety of activities, including homework help, robotics, team sports, karate, dance, and music.
